On Wed, Jun 08, 2022 at 08:46:21PM +0200, Caspar Schutijser wrote: > Hi, > > On Wed, Jun 08, 2022 at 02:04:47PM +0000, Yifei Zhan wrote: > > here is a security update for Tor browser: > > > > - update to Tor browser 11.0.14 > > - update to NoScript 11.4.6 > > - update to Firefox ESR 91.10 > > https://www.mozilla.org/en-US/security/advisories/mfsa2022-21/ > > > > - tested .onion access/CJK fonts/JS blocking, no issue so far. > > - -stable patch will be sent tomorrow, my -stable test box is still > > building... > > > > changelog: > > https://blog.torproject.org/new-release-tor-browser-11014/ > > Thanks for your diff and your testing, I have the same diff but I also > synced the recent unveil changes that were recently applied to > www/firefox-esr. > > Feedback or OKs?
And here is a diff for -stable (still building here). OK provided that it builds? Caspar Index: meta/tor-browser/Makefile =================================================================== RCS file: /cvs/ports/meta/tor-browser/Makefile,v retrieving revision 1.53.2.2 diff -u -p -r1.53.2.2 Makefile --- meta/tor-browser/Makefile 24 May 2022 14:23:10 -0000 1.53.2.2 +++ meta/tor-browser/Makefile 8 Jun 2022 18:51:32 -0000 @@ -2,11 +2,11 @@ COMMENT= Tor Browser meta package MAINTAINER= Caspar Schutijser <cas...@schutijser.com> -PKGNAME= tor-browser-11.0.13 +PKGNAME= tor-browser-11.0.14 ONLY_FOR_ARCHS = amd64 -RUN_DEPENDS= www/tor-browser/browser>=11.0.13 \ - www/tor-browser/noscript>=11.4.5 \ +RUN_DEPENDS= www/tor-browser/browser>=11.0.14 \ + www/tor-browser/noscript>=11.4.6 \ net/tor>=0.4.7.7 .include <bsd.port.mk> Index: www/tor-browser/Makefile.inc =================================================================== RCS file: /cvs/ports/www/tor-browser/Makefile.inc,v retrieving revision 1.51.2.2 diff -u -p -r1.51.2.2 Makefile.inc --- www/tor-browser/Makefile.inc 24 May 2022 14:23:10 -0000 1.51.2.2 +++ www/tor-browser/Makefile.inc 8 Jun 2022 18:51:32 -0000 @@ -3,7 +3,7 @@ HOMEPAGE ?= https://www.torproject.org PERMIT_PACKAGE ?= Yes CATEGORIES = www BROWSER_NAME = tor-browser -TB_VERSION = 11.0.13 +TB_VERSION = 11.0.14 TB_PREFIX = tb SUBST_VARS += BROWSER_NAME TB_VERSION Index: www/tor-browser/browser/Makefile =================================================================== RCS file: /cvs/ports/www/tor-browser/browser/Makefile,v retrieving revision 1.78.2.2 diff -u -p -r1.78.2.2 Makefile --- www/tor-browser/browser/Makefile 24 May 2022 14:23:10 -0000 1.78.2.2 +++ www/tor-browser/browser/Makefile 8 Jun 2022 18:51:32 -0000 @@ -15,7 +15,7 @@ EXTRACT_SUFX = .tar.xz PATCHORIG = .pat.orig PKGNAME = ${TB_PREFIX}-browser-${TB_VERSION} -DISTNAME = src-firefox-tor-browser-91.9.0esr-11.0-1-build2 +DISTNAME = src-firefox-tor-browser-91.10.0esr-11.0-1-build1 FIX_EXTRACT_PERMISSIONS = Yes EXTRACT_ONLY += ${DISTNAME}.tar.xz \ Index: www/tor-browser/browser/distinfo =================================================================== RCS file: /cvs/ports/www/tor-browser/browser/distinfo,v retrieving revision 1.49.2.2 diff -u -p -r1.49.2.2 distinfo --- www/tor-browser/browser/distinfo 24 May 2022 14:23:10 -0000 1.49.2.2 +++ www/tor-browser/browser/distinfo 8 Jun 2022 18:51:32 -0000 @@ -1,8 +1,8 @@ SHA256 (mozilla/https-everywhere-2021.4.15-eff.xpi) = fl9ygI6hSL7M1BbsvfM+oevEOkMuTnhbXl4TObeitwg= -SHA256 (mozilla/src-firefox-tor-browser-91.9.0esr-11.0-1-build2.tar.xz) = Oqn4Pg3bYanVRz4Iav2164Wue6MpWXIpwwLqp4SnWuc= +SHA256 (mozilla/src-firefox-tor-browser-91.10.0esr-11.0-1-build1.tar.xz) = 04NnD5ZDiIpA/6MaDQ40df1Y/1Qf+oLe8+U4q6mXiKI= SHA256 (mozilla/src-tor-launcher-0.2.33.tar.xz) = ZG7lH5mBhkCRA26AEdCo52HP0iNlHKbRKl/BKyP0C9U= -SHA256 (mozilla/tor-browser-linux64-11.0.13_en-US.tar.xz) = 32H9kLfBAzy7WFbz0Ha1yhnyfpPBqEdBvYOwGd/n/w4= +SHA256 (mozilla/tor-browser-linux64-11.0.14_en-US.tar.xz) = tgaST9+CN+aXz5XCKRidpYdcGQh11yl2llXHtnrrmqY= SIZE (mozilla/https-everywhere-2021.4.15-eff.xpi) = 1746434 -SIZE (mozilla/src-firefox-tor-browser-91.9.0esr-11.0-1-build2.tar.xz) = 413001404 +SIZE (mozilla/src-firefox-tor-browser-91.10.0esr-11.0-1-build1.tar.xz) = 413196916 SIZE (mozilla/src-tor-launcher-0.2.33.tar.xz) = 229992 -SIZE (mozilla/tor-browser-linux64-11.0.13_en-US.tar.xz) = 86606348 +SIZE (mozilla/tor-browser-linux64-11.0.14_en-US.tar.xz) = 87620816 Index: www/tor-browser/browser/files/unveil.content =================================================================== RCS file: /cvs/ports/www/tor-browser/browser/files/unveil.content,v retrieving revision 1.5 diff -u -p -r1.5 unveil.content --- www/tor-browser/browser/files/unveil.content 9 Mar 2022 20:48:32 -0000 1.5 +++ www/tor-browser/browser/files/unveil.content 8 Jun 2022 18:51:32 -0000 @@ -1,4 +1,4 @@ -/dev/dri/card0 rw +/dev/dri rw /etc/fonts r /etc/machine-id r @@ -33,6 +33,7 @@ $XDG_CONFIG_HOME/fontconfig r $XDG_CONFIG_HOME/gtk-3.0 r $XDG_CONFIG_HOME/mimeapps.list r $XDG_CONFIG_HOME/user-dirs.dirs r +$XDG_CACHE_HOME/fontconfig r $XDG_DATA_HOME/applications r $XDG_DATA_HOME/applnk r $XDG_DATA_HOME/fonts r Index: www/tor-browser/noscript/Makefile =================================================================== RCS file: /cvs/ports/www/tor-browser/noscript/Makefile,v retrieving revision 1.41.2.1 diff -u -p -r1.41.2.1 Makefile --- www/tor-browser/noscript/Makefile 9 May 2022 16:08:48 -0000 1.41.2.1 +++ www/tor-browser/noscript/Makefile 8 Jun 2022 18:51:32 -0000 @@ -1,5 +1,5 @@ ADDON_NAME = noscript -V = 11.4.5 +V = 11.4.6 COMMENT = Tor Browser add-on: flexible JS blocker HOMEPAGE = https://noscript.net MASTER_SITES = https://secure.informaction.com/download/releases/ Index: www/tor-browser/noscript/distinfo =================================================================== RCS file: /cvs/ports/www/tor-browser/noscript/distinfo,v retrieving revision 1.36.2.1 diff -u -p -r1.36.2.1 distinfo --- www/tor-browser/noscript/distinfo 9 May 2022 16:08:48 -0000 1.36.2.1 +++ www/tor-browser/noscript/distinfo 8 Jun 2022 18:51:32 -0000 @@ -1,2 +1,2 @@ -SHA256 (noscript-11.4.5.xpi) = KkOQG/25JQ0wuAXnes2aNEulV7wyWtb8T5XIDLohuEA= -SIZE (noscript-11.4.5.xpi) = 903018 +SHA256 (noscript-11.4.6.xpi) = X5F+VKUtcmmVmXbrtutB8aFMBHww1fe9akAf5BJvCzo= +SIZE (noscript-11.4.6.xpi) = 915963